Abstract
As aminoacyl adenylate surrogates, a series of methionyl and isoleucyl phen olic analogues containing bioisosteric linkers mimicking ribose have been i nvestigated. Inhibition of synthesized compounds to the aminoacylation reac tion b?i the corresponding Escherichia coli methionyl-tRNA and isoleucyl-tR NA synthetases indicated that 18 was found to be a potent inhibitor of isol eucyl-tRNA synthetase. A molecular modeling study demonstrated that in 18. isovanillate and hydroxamate served as proper surrogates for adenine and ri bose in isoleucyl adenylate, respectively.
